Abstract

The problem of regularization and renormalization of the Casimir pressure in a finite area with a smooth boundary is considered using the example of a real scalar field in the two-dimensional case. A procedure for the renormalization of boundary pressure using a certain modified area and a method for approximate calculation of the Green’s function and its derivatives with the use of efficient surface charges are proposed. For problems that allow an exact solution, it is shown that the method has high accuracy and computational efficiency.
